On a reef in Hawaii, our hero, called Bad Eyes, is a very small Manini fish with poor eyesight. Ushered to the rear of his school, he is charged to act as bait for predators, but is also able to survive as the fastest swimmer in the school. Will his scary life change when a pair of Marsha’s glasses fall into the water above him. Curious to investigate, he swims up to peer at the clear glassy circles, when they suddenly fasten over his eyes. Diving to retrieve her glasses, Marsha meets Bad Eyes, now seeing better than any fish on the reef. They magically begin to speak. Marsha offers her glasses to Bad Eyes. This help save his school, but will he watch the reef for other marauders, like a school of sharks? And can they also help protect the reef? Can he help a desolate sea turtle looking for a quiet place to lay her eggs? An easily disguised octopus, the most intelligent animal on the reef, may offer aid as a most aware travelor among the choral chasms.? Will he gain the respect of a school of giant barracuda, to help with warnings of fisherman coming to drop their bottom nets on the reef, causing damage and death to all that are caught in them? With the help of Marsha their adventure insures for the both of them a confidence and understanding about the needed balance of nature to preserve our reefs legacy for our future.
